An analysis of factors influencing omnichannel retailing adoption using ISM-DEMATEL approach: an Indian perspective

Ruchi Mishra

Summary: The study uses an integrated approach of interpretive structural modelling (ISM) and decision-making trial and evaluation laboratory (DEMATEL) to identify and analyze the key factors influencing omnichannel retailing adoption in Indian apparel firms. The findings suggest that financial commitment, technological capability, training and development, performance metrics, supportive organizational structure, collaboration and knowledge sharing, offline-online information aggregation, and integrated technological platform are crucial factors. Financial commitment and supportive organizational structure impact the majority of factors but are affected by only a few factors. Practitioners are advised to focus on leading factors such as financial commitments, supportive organizational structure, technological capability, integrated technological platform and training and development when considering omnichannel retailing adoption. The integrated approach of ISM-DEMATEL provides a hierarchical model and cause-effect relationship among factors influencing omnichannel retailing adoption.
